Output fe912ae150500e3cee53fe02961ce8fc57f6644427c6d9d2f7fc25b51d53cc17:0

value
300000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ec39bce58288a7684f222521b8f15ddc3797c4c OP_EQUAL
address
3335iMWPHZWLFmomaLVKBERgu7MZckaApn
transaction
fe912ae150500e3cee53fe02961ce8fc57f6644427c6d9d2f7fc25b51d53cc17
confirmations
238018
spent
true